Output 960229acecfed0dc0e96faaa520c36849bba6bc09f03bbefe54a3e4e849a4ea7:0

value
532182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e4bcb79810d54dd8c2263364ea8ff371224eb5 OP_EQUAL
address
3KTX2hMGBPEbjj3Up2TqevcB2dr9dz6Znr
transaction
960229acecfed0dc0e96faaa520c36849bba6bc09f03bbefe54a3e4e849a4ea7
confirmations
151445
spent
true